Deputy Clinic Manager – Renal Services
Location: Gloucestershire | Salary: Up to £45,637 + On-Call Allowance
Are you an experienced renal nurse ready to take the next step into leadership? This is an excellent opportunity to join a well-established, patient-focused dialysis provider in a Deputy Clinic Manager position, offering clear progression into a Clinic Manager role.
The Opportunity
We are recruiting for a Deputy Clinic Manager to support the leadership of a modern dialysis unit in Gloucestershire. This is a replacement role within a high-performing team, offering strong development opportunities and exposure to both operational and clinical leadership.
The clinic is a 29-station unit, working closely with NHS partners and delivering high standards of patient-centred care. Opened in 2023 and based within a hospital setting, the service also supports inpatient care, with potential for future expansion.
You’ll work closely with the Clinic Manager, taking responsibility for the day-to-day running of the service and stepping up in their absence.
Key Responsibilities
- Support the overall management of clinic operations and clinical standards
- Lead, supervise, and develop a team of nursing staff
- Manage rotas, staffing levels, and patient scheduling
- Oversee audits, stock control, and regulatory compliance
- Maintain high standards of care in line with renal best practice guidelines
- Build strong relationships with patients, families, and multidisciplinary teams
Working Pattern
Monday to Saturday shifts (mix of long and short days) – No nights or Sundays, but includes on-call rota.
About You
- NMC Registered Nurse
- Essential: UK haemodialysis experience
- Essential: Recognised renal qualification/course
- Proven experience in a senior or leadership role within a dialysis setting
- Confident managing clinical operations and leading a team
- Motivated to progress into a Clinic Manager position
